Pro Tips for Making the German Chocolate Poke Cake

  • Use room temperature ingredients: For a smoother batter and better rise, ensure all your ingredients are at room temperature.
  • Let the cake cool slightly: Allowing the cake to cool for 10-15 minutes before poking holes prevents the milk and caramel from dripping straight through.
  • Customize the toppings: Feel free to add extra toppings like whipped cream or additional chocolate chips based on your preference.
  • Storage: Cover the cake and refrigerate it to maintain its moisture. It’s best enjoyed within a few days.
  • Nut-Free Options: Omit the pecans and substitute with more shredded coconut for a nut-free version.

Ingredients

Before you get started, gather the following ingredients:

  • 1 box of German chocolate cake mix plus ingredients needed for the mix
  • 1 cup sweetened condensed milk
  • 1 cup caramel sauce
  • 1/2 cup chocolate chips
  • 1/2 cup shredded coconut
  • 1/2 cup chopped pecans
  • 1/2 cup chocolate frosting
  • 1/2 cup caramel frosting

Optional substitutions include using coconut milk instead of sweetened condensed milk and dairy-free chocolate chips for a dairy-free version.

Instructions

  • Step 1: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9×13-inch baking dish.
  • Step 2: Prepare the German chocolate cake mix according to the package instructions and pour the batter into the prepared baking dish.
  • Step 3: Bake the cake as directed on the box. Once done, remove it from the oven and let it cool slightly.
  • Step 4: Using the handle of a wooden spoon, poke holes all over the cake.
  • Step 5: Pour the sweetened condensed milk evenly over the cake, followed by the caramel sauce.
  • Step 6: Sprinkle chocolate chips, shredded coconut, and chopped pecans evenly over the cake.
  • Step 7: Heat the chocolate frosting and caramel frosting slightly in the microwave until they are pourable and drizzle them over the cake.
  • Step 8: Allow the cake to sit for at least 30 minutes to let the flavors meld together.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is a poke cake?

A poke cake is a cake that has holes poked in it, allowing various toppings or fillings to soak in for added flavor and moisture.

Can I make this cake a day in advance?

Absolutely! In fact, letting the cake sit overnight in the refrigerator can enhance the flavors.

What if I don’t have German chocolate cake mix?

You can use a regular chocolate cake mix, but the flavor profile will differ slightly.

How do I store leftover cake?

Cover the cake with plastic wrap or foil and store it in the refrigerator for up to 4 days.

Can I freeze this cake?

You can freeze the cake without toppings for up to 3 months. Thaw it in the fridge before serving.
